The Heart of America Aquarium Society will be hosting it's annual Swap Meet on August 25th, 2012 at the Palmer Center in Independence, MO.

If you haven't been to a swap meet before, think of it as a gigantic "garage sale" of aquarium related items. This is a great time to get deals on all sorts of things, from aquariums, filters, heaters, lights, fish, plants, and essentially anything aquarium related. Some folks bring tanks filled with fish, and net and bag them out right there.

Each "vendor" has one or more tables where they sell their wares to the public. They are responsible for collecting money for themselves.

Tables this year are only $10.00.

LOCATION: Palmer Center
218 N. Pleasant St.
Independence, MO 64050

DATE: August 25th, 2012
TIME:
Setup - 10:00 AM
Open to Public - 12:00 PM
Ends 2:00 PM (may go later than that)
